Как происходит перенос блоков между разными уровнями кеша - PullRequest
0 голосов
/ 20 мая 2018

Я пытался понять передачу блока между двумя уровнями кэша (предположим, L1 и L2), пусть L1 имеет размер блока 4 слова, а L2 имеет размер блока 16 слов, шина данных между L1 и L2имеет 4 слова.Если в кеше L1 произойдет промах, как будет происходить передача данных, - это все слова, передаваемые одновременно в parellel (между кешем L1 и L2) с одним доступом к памяти (поскольку размер шины данных равендо размера кэша L1) или требуется 4 обращения к памяти для передачи 4 слов между кэшем L1 и L2.Пожалуйста, помогите.

Добро пожаловать на сайт PullRequest, где вы можете задавать вопросы и получать ответы от других членов сообщества.
...